Tailoring Your Motivation Letter for Administration Management

Crafting a compelling motivation letter is vital when applying for an administration management opportunity. Your letter should showcase your skills and reveal your passion for the sector.

To meaningfully tailor your motivation letter, consider the specific requirements outlined in the job description. Identify the primary characteristics they are seeking and align your history accordingly.

Furthermore, investigate the organization completely. Grasping their values will enable you to articulate how your achievements can advance their targets.

Keep in mind that a well-tailored motivation letter differentiates you from other candidates and boosts your chances of landing an interview.

Demonstrating Your Value: A Management Letter Template

Crafting a compelling management letter can enhance your professional standing and illustrate your value to key stakeholders. A well-structured letter presents your contributions in a concise and convincing manner, placing you as a valuable asset within the organization. A management letter template can serve as a blueprint to help you effectively communicate your worth.

  • Initiate by stating the purpose of the letter and identifying the target audience.
  • Summarize your key accomplishments and contributions during the specified period.
  • Demonstrate your impact using metrics whenever possible.
  • Address any challenges you overcame and your strategies for resolution them.
  • Summarize by reiterating your value proposition and expressing your dedication to continued success.

Customize the template to reflect your specific role and industry. Proofread carefully for any errors.

Landing Your Dream Management Position: A Guide to Crafting a Compelling Letter

Crafting an impactful management application letter necessitates careful thought. Your letter must showcase your distinctive skill set and highlight your capacity to excel in a leadership role.

Here are some essential tips to enhance the effectiveness of your management application letter:

* Start with a strong opening paragraph that grabs the reader's focus.

* Detail your relevant experience and accomplishments in a brief manner.

* Measure your outcomes whenever possible. Numbers speak louder than copyright.

* Showcase your executive qualities through concrete examples.

* Tailor your letter to the specific expectations of the opportunity.

* Conclude with a assured call to action, manifesting your eagerness in the opportunity.

By following these suggestions, you can craft a management application letter that successfully showcases your value to a potential employer.
